Angels and Visitations

"Angels and Visitations" is a collection of short fiction and nonfiction by Neil Gaiman. It was first published in the US in 1993 by DreamHaven Books.

It is illustrated by Steve Bissette, Randy Broecker, Dave McKean, P. Craig Russell, Jill Carla Schwarz, Bill Sienkiewicz, Charles Vess, and Michael Zulli.

Many of the stories in this book are reprints from other sources, such as magazines and anthologies.

Included stories and poems:

* The Song of the Audience
* Chivalry
* Nicholas Was...
* Babycakes
* Troll-Bridge
* Vampire Sestina
* Webs
* Six to Six
* A Prologue
* Foreign Parts
* Cold Colours
* Luther's Villanelle
* Auto Insurance
* Mouse
* Gumshoe
* [http://www.neilgaiman.com/p/Cool%20Stuff/Short%20Stories/The%20Case%20of%20the%20Four%20and%20Twenty%20Blackbirds The Case of the Four and Twenty Blackbirds]
* Virus
* Looking for the Girl
* Post-Mortem on Our Love
* Being an Experiment Upon Strictly Scientific Lines
* We Can Get Them For You Wholesale
* The Mystery of Father Brown
* Murder Mysteries
